Noise has launched a new wireless headset, the Airwave Max 6, expanding its premium audio portfolio in the country. The latest model follows the Airwave Max 5, bringing advanced connectivity, battery performance and sound features to the series.
The Noise Airwave Max 6 features a coaxial dual-driver setup with 40mm drivers and 12mm drivers. The company says the system is designed to deliver balanced output of bass, midrange and treble while maintaining sound clarity. The headphones are Hi-Res Audio certified and support LDAC, a codec designed to transmit high-resolution audio over Bluetooth. This allows users to stream music with more audio data than standard wireless codecs.
The device also includes spatial or 3D audio support, designed to create a wider soundstage during music playback, movie streaming, gaming sessions and virtual meetings. In terms of noise control, Airwave Max 6 features intelligent adaptive hybrid active noise cancellation. According to the company, the system reduces ambient noise by up to 45dB and adjusts in real time based on surrounding sound levels.

For voice calls, the headset comes with a five-microphone array. The setup includes wind noise reduction technology to help improve call clarity in outdoor environments. The product connects via Bluetooth 6.0, providing wireless compatibility with smartphones, tablets, and laptops.
Battery life is one of the main highlights of the Airwave Max 6. In standard listening mode, the headphones are said to provide up to 120 hours of playback time on a single charge. With active noise cancellation enabled, playback time may be reduced to up to 80 hours. The device also supports fast charging. A 10-minute charge is said to provide up to 15 hours of listening time.

Noise designed the Airwave Max 6 to last longer. The headphones have an over-ear form factor and are designed to support long listening sessions, whether for work or play. The company offers a one-year warranty on the product.

In India, the Noise Airwave Max 6 is priced at Rs. 6,999. It’s available in four colors: Dune White, Cobalt Blue, Forest Green, and Carbon Black. Interested buyers can purchase the earphones through the company’s official website and e-commerce platforms including Amazon and Flipkart.
